Xserve G5(Cluster Node)
The 64-bit Xserve G5.
Background
The Xserve G5 brought the architectural improvements of the PowerMac G5 to the Xserve line. In addition to adding single or dual 2.0 GHz PowerPC 970FX processors, the Xserve G5 included dramatically faster data and memory buses, more and faster RAM, FireWire 800 and USB 2.0, Serial ATA and PCI-X support. The Xserve G5 was available in two configurations: a single 2.0 GHz processor model with 512 MB of RAM for $2,999 U.S. and a dual 2.0 GHz processor model with 1.0 GB of RAM for $3,999 U.S. A Cluster Node configuration of the Xserve G5 was also available.
